Explore fusible collage as textile artist Laura Wasilowski shows you how to make a whimsical art quilt! You’ll begin with a simple sketch (use your own or Laura’s design), then convert your drawing into a master pattern. Use bold, hand-dyed hues and batiks to create fused fabric design elements, and follow along with Laura to assemble a countryside scene. Next, add dynamic dimension to your quilt with collage! Discover fun, fast techniques to turn fabric strips into a grassy foreground and lovely lake, and add playful pizazz to your composition with a quick color-chip trick and textural tiled collage. Then, showcase each element of your landscape with a variety of gorgeous machine-quilting motifs, including wavy, vein and sketching stitches. Finally, attach a rod pocket to the back for display — you’re going to want to show this quilt off!
Class Sessions
Sketching the Design
10:12
Meet your instructor, expert art quilter Laura Wasilowski, and preview the gorgeous landscape quilt you'll create in class. Laura eases you into the process by demonstrating simple techniques for sketching out your quilt design ideas. In addition, you'll learn how to convert any sketch into a master pattern.
Fusing Fabric & Fields
29:20
Start working on your landscape quilt! Get Laura's advice on choosing the right fabrics and color palettes. Then, follow along as Laura details how to transfer a pattern onto fabric, work with fusible web and assemble the rolling farm fields design. Plus, gain valuable tips on creating a variety of patterned collages.
Creating the Grass, Water & Sky
17:13
Practice the skills you learned in the previous lesson by making three more collages for the quilt top. You'll learn how to create the grassy foreground and a rippling lake by working with bias-cut strips. In addition, Laura demonstrates an easy way to make intricate cutout patterns in your fabric.
Finishing the Collage
18:45
Complete the landscape composition you started in Lesson 2. Discover Laura's technique for creating a fun color-chip treetops collage. You'll also get in-depth instruction on building a tiled collage -- perfect for adding texture to any design. Plus, see how to tack your collage to the background fabric.
Free-Motion Stitches
23:59
Once you've completed your collage, it's time to start stitching! Learn how to steam set the quilt top to the batting, then follow along as Laura demonstrates her versatile free-motion ME-ME-ME stitch. You'll also see Laura's method of creating rows of jagged grass with the sketching stitch.
More Free-Motion Stitches
17:30
Add more free-motion stitches to your repertoire. Watch and learn Laura's technique of creating wavy, flowing stitches across the water collage. Then, add in detail to the foreground leaves with an arch-shaped vein stitch. You'll also discover two highly versatile stitches for the sky and quilt border.
Assembling the Quilt
12:53
Put the finishing touches on your art quilt! Laura demonstrates how to stitch a signature into the quilt top. You'll get step-by-step instruction on squaring up the quilt and adding a fused binding. Plus, find out how to attach a rod pocket to the back of any quilt.
Your Instructor
Laura Wasilowski
Laura Wasilowski teaches quilting and fabric art workshops around the United States, and her quilts have been exhibited internationally. She is the author of several books, including Fanciful Stitches, Colorful Quilts, and has appeared on HGTVs Simply Quilts. Laura is also the owner of ArtFabrik, an online shop for hand-dyed fabric and thread.
